Core Advantages of 96V 300Ah LiFePO4 Battery Pack (for Logistics Robots)
1. 28.8kWh High Energy for 48+ Hour Logistics Robot Runtime
96V 300Ah LiFePO4 Battery Pack delivers 28.8kWh total energy:It supports 48+ hours of continuous operation for high-volume warehouse sorting logistics robots — enough to cover 2 full daily shifts (e.g., 10,000+ parcel sorts) without recharging.For heavy-load logistics handling robots, this capacity powers 36+ hours of non-stop material transfers across large industrial warehouses.
2. 350A Peak Discharge for Ultra-Heavy Logistics Cargo Lifts
Tailored for logistics robot heavy-load needs:350A peak discharge enables heavy-load logistics handling robots to lift 1500+ kg pallets or bulk cargo — critical for large-scale industrial warehouse material transfer.200A continuous discharge sustains stable performance through frequent load shifts (common in busy logistics sorting yards).
3. IP67 Protection for Harsh Logistics Environments
Built for warehouse/cold storage logistics scenarios:IP67 dust/waterproof rating shields the battery from warehouse dust accumulation, liquid spills (e.g., cargo coolant leaks), and low-temperature condensation (in cold storage) — no performance loss in typical logistics work environments.
4. ≥3500 System Cycles for Low-Cost Logistics Robot Fleets
Optimized for high-frequency logistics use:≥3500 system cycles mean this 96V 300Ah LiFePO4 Battery Pack lasts 2.5x longer than standard alternatives. For a 5-unit heavy-load logistics robot fleet, this cuts replacement costs by 80% over 3 years.
5. CAN+RS485 Communication for Logistics Robot Fleet Coordination
Syncs with logistics operations:CAN+RS485 communication transmits real-time battery data (state of charge, temperature, cycle count) to logistics robot fleet management systems. Managers can schedule charging to align with off-peak sorting hours, minimizing logistics workflow downtime.
